The ornamental gates at the entrance to Kingswood Park from the High Street.
The gates are interesting in showing the coat of arms of Kingswood Urban District Council. The Arms were chosen in a competition in 1944 and reflect the bringing together of Hanham and Kingswood. Hanham "in the hundred of Swineshead" (Doomsday Book) is represented by a boar's head. The royal ermine border reflects the King's land and the two golden stags' heads, the royal forest of Kingswood.
